Spencer Pratt Forgives MK Olsen For Being a Badly Dressed Troll

Posted by Fara Kearnes on June 30, 2008 3:47 PM |

spencer prattSpencer Pratt is out peddling his lil barely there career by calling out Mary-Kate Olsen who dissed him on the David Letterman Show while promoting her film 'The Wackness'. Pratt hissed back by telling Us magazine: "I don't really get why she'd use my name to get press for her little indie film that no one's going to see."

"She should probably focus more on not getting dressed in the dark than on me," the Hills guy said. "I know I've made it in Hollywood when a famous troll is talking about me on Letterman."

"I forgive her, though. She's had to go through life as the less cute twin, which must be tough."

Not as tough as going through life as a douchebag, eh Spencer?

While promoting her film, MK told Letterman that Pratt played soccer at her high school and "he does not have a good temper. He would walk off the field."

But Pratt told Us that Olsen went to Campbell Hall in North Hollywood while he attended Crossroads School in Santa Monica.

Mary-Kate and David Letterman spoke thusly of Spencer:

Mary-Kate: He does not have a good temper. He walked out of a few games. He would walk off the field. He was like, 'Me or the coach!'
Dave: Were you friends with the guy at the time?
Mary-Kate: No.
Dave: Because I'm surprised about the soccer. Because looking at the guy, he looks like a guy that has never broken a sweat, I would guess.
Mary-Kate: Oh, my God — that brings up stories! I don't know if I should talk about it.
Dave: No, c'mon, let's hear one. Let's go.
Mary-Kate: [laughs] The Wackness is a great film.
Dave: What I don't understand is how does a kid that age, and he's only in his 20s or maybe even your age, how does a kid like that get to be so oily?
Mary-Kate: It's a mystery to me.

Why the subject of Spencer Pratt even came up is a mystery but whatever. Surprisingly, the whole Spencer-MK spat is making Mary-Kate look less troll-like and more human.
